Registry of Service Providers  
  Welcome to the Registry of Service Providers (“Registry”).

The Registry has been updated as of 15 January 2012.

The Registry contains information of service providers that have registered with Visa in Asia Pacific, Central Europe, Middle East and Africa. Please note that Visa does not in any way endorse the service providers or their business processes or practices. Visa did not perform any due diligence on these service providers as part of the registration process. Information on the Registry is as represented to Visa by the service providers.

1
Visa did not review the Report on Compliance issued by the Qualified Security Assessor (QSA).

The reviews are valid for one year, with the next annual attestation due to Visa one year from the "VALIDATION RENEWAL DATE". Attestations that are from 1-60 days overdue are highlighted in Yellow and attestations that are from 61-90 days overdue are highlighted in Red. Service providers with attestations over 90 days past due are removed from this list. It is the responsibility of each Visa issuer or acquirer to use compliant service providers and to follow up with service providers if there are any questions about their compliance status.

2 Please note that the reviews represent only a "snapshot" of security in place at the time of the review, and do not guarantee that those security controls remain in place after the review is complete. These reviews did not cover proprietary software solutions that may be used or sold by these service providers.

3 Approved Card Vendors in “Warning” mode are highlighted in Yellow. This means that the vendors failed to correct non-compliance issues within 30 days from the issuance of the warning letter by Visa. These vendors are required to notify their clients of their remediation status.
